Job Description

Established Brands Medical Scientist-Contractor

The Established Brands medical scientist-contractor is responsible for the medical oversight of activities for brands in late stages of life cycle and those which have undergone Loss-of-Exclusivity.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Lead medical input for brand cross-functional teams for assigned products.
  • Provide medical input to patient safety monitoring of the brand and available literature findings, propose labeling recommendations based on signal detection activities and pharmacovigilance findings.
  • Provide Medical Assessments of Risk/Benefit of assigned products regarding new indications, safety or stability issues, medical necessity/sensitivity assessments or other actions that require reappraisal of the product Risk/Benefit.
  • Provide medical input for regulatory requirements, including Response to Health Authorities queries and support for registration renewals and label periodic reviews.
  • Provide medical support to the Company Core Data Sheet content review and development.
  • Provide medical evaluation and appropriate communications to additional documents and activities such as: Dear Health Care Professional letters, Clinical Overview for Type II variation, Periodic Benefit-Risk Evaluation regulatory document submissions and coordinate expert reports.
  • Compliance Support delivery of medical affairs compliance needs for the assigned portfolio as appropriate.
